Essential for this job:
Hilary is looking for a support worker who understands trauma and its effects. She hasn't had the easiest of lives, which influences her feelings about herself and the world around her, including her support team. When feeling scared, she may strike out at those closest to her.
She needs someone who can maintain boundaries even when challenged, with skills and knowledge related to working with challenging behaviour, and who possesses a high level of emotional intelligence to avoid taking things personally if Hilary reacts negatively. Resilience is key—someone who will persist regardless of her words or actions. Patience is essential, as building trust with Hilary takes time due to her life experiences.
Hilary is a joy to be around; she enjoys laughter, jokes, watching soaps, supporting Plymouth Argyle, and takes pride in her appearance and her home. If you can get through the initial challenging period, this can be a very rewarding role. We offer full training, ongoing support, and potential career growth as our organization expands.
